Understanding Different Printer Types
Inkjet Printers: The Versatile Choice
Inkjet printers are among the most popular options for both home and office use. They work by spraying tiny droplets of ink onto paper, allowing for high-quality prints, especially in color. If you need a printer that can handle everything from documents to stunning photos, an inkjet might be the best computer printer to buy.
Why Choose an Inkjet?
- Affordability: Inkjet printers are generally cheaper upfront compared to other types.
- Quality: They produce vibrant colors and detailed images.
- Compact Size: Ideal for home offices with limited space.
When looking for an inkjet printer, check for features such as wireless connectivity, mobile printing options, and the cost of replacement ink cartridges.
Laser Printers: Speed and Efficiency
If you frequently print large volumes of documents, a laser printer could be your best bet. These printers use toner instead of ink and are known for their speed and efficiency. They are particularly well-suited for business environments where high-quality text documents are essential.
Benefits of Laser Printers:
- Fast Printing: They can print multiple pages per minute, saving you time.
- Cost-Effective: Lower cost per page compared to inkjet printers.
- Durability: Generally, laser printers last longer and require less maintenance.
When considering a laser printer, look for features like duplex printing (automatic double-sided printing) and network connectivity options.
All-in-One Printers: The Ultimate Convenience
All-in-one printers combine printing, scanning, copying, and sometimes faxing into one device. This makes them extremely versatile and a great space-saver.
Advantages of All-in-One Printers:
- Multi-functionality: Perfect for home offices or small businesses.
- Cost-Effective: Saves you money by combining multiple machines into one.
- User-Friendly: Many come with touch screens and easy-to-navigate menus.
When choosing an all-in-one printer, consider the size, speed, and the quality of scans and copies it can produce.
Key Features to Consider
Print Quality: What Matters Most?
When it comes to choosing a printer, print quality is often the most important factor. Whether you’re printing documents, photos, or graphics, you want clear, crisp results. Look for specifications like DPI (dots per inch) to gauge print quality.
Connectivity Options: Stay Connected
In our connected world, having a printer with multiple connectivity options is essential. Look for printers that offer:
- Wi-Fi Connectivity: For easy wireless printing from your devices.
- Mobile Printing: Compatibility with apps like Apple AirPrint or Google Cloud Print.
- USB and Ethernet Ports: For direct connections if needed.
Cost of Supplies: Budget Wisely
Understanding the ongoing costs associated with your printer is crucial. Inkjet printers may have lower upfront costs, but ink cartridges can be pricey. Laser printers typically have higher initial costs but lower ongoing costs due to toner longevity. Always consider the price of replacement ink or toner when making your decision.
